The following information appears in the viewfinder.

Viewfinder

1

AF frame (p.47)

2

Spot metering frame (p.98)

3

AF point (p.105)

4

Flash status (p.62)

Lit: when flash is available.
Blinks: when flash is recommended but not set.

5

Focus mode (p.102)

Appears when AF Mode is set to

k (Continuous mode) or \.

6

Picture/Scene mode icon (p.78)

Icon for Picture mode or Scene mode in use appears.
\ (Moving Object), q (Macro), = (Portrait), U (Normal mode in I),

. (Night Scene Portrait), s (Landscape), H (Scene)

7

Shutter speed (p.81)

Shutter speed when capturing or adjusting.
Underlined when shutter speed can be adjusted with the e-dial.

8

Aperture value (p.82)

Aperture value when capturing or adjusting.
Underlined when aperture value can be adjusted with the e-dial.
